Vinythai PCL business model

Vinythai PCL is a leading company in the production and sale of vinyl chemicals in Thailand and worldwide. It was established in 1989 and is headquartered in Bangkok. Vinythai is a subsidiary of Solvay SA, a Belgian chemical company. Vinythai PCL is one of the most popular companies on Eulerpool.com.

What is the history and background of the company Vinythai PCL?

Vinythai PCL is a leading Thai company in the petrochemical industry. Established in 1988, Vinythai PCL specializes in producing and distributing polyvinyl chloride (PVC) and caustic soda, essential raw materials for various industries. The company operates a state-of-the-art manufacturing plant in Map Ta Phut, Thailand.
